IBM Power Systems

Developers should learn IBM Power Systems when working in enterprise environments that require high availability, strong security, and support for legacy applications, particularly in sectors like banking or insurance that rely on IBM i or AIX

x86 Servers

Developers should learn about x86 servers when working in enterprise IT, cloud computing, or DevOps, as they are the backbone of most on-premises and cloud infrastructure

Pros

  • +They are essential for deploying and managing web applications, databases, and containerized services, offering a standardized environment for development and production
